Mechanic 2, Equipment
On-site · Thonotosassa, Florida, United States
Job Summary
Mechanic 2, Equipment responsible for high-level skilled mechanical work including maintenance, repair, overhaul and replacement of gasoline and diesel engines across automobiles, trucks, heavy equipment and related machinery. Primary duties include disassembly/inspection of parts with precision tools, overhaul/ replacement of carburetors, ignition systems, brakes and alignment, welding and minor body repairs, preparing materials, coordinating with school staff, and ensuring safety and compliance per OSHA standards. Requires operating and using hand and power tools, adherence to safety protocols, after-hours response, and documentation of inventory and service activities. Preference given to veteran status and spouses of veterans.
Required Qualifications
- Six (6) years of increasingly responsible experience in all types of automotive and vehicular equipment
- Must possess a Class E Driver’s License and comply with HCPS Safe Driver Plan
- Phase II Class B Driver’s License must be obtained within 90 days of hire date
- Read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instruction, and procedure manuals
- Mathematical Skills: Add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ure
- Reasoning Ability: Ap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form
- Computer Skills: Microsoft Office
- Language Skills: Read, write, speak clearly
- Physical demands and other requirements described in the posting
